Curso Arduino Con Matlab y LabVIEW

4
INCULCAMOS RAZONAMIENTO Arduino + MATLAB + LabVIEW Nivel Básico - Avanzado Curso Arduino con Matlab y LabVIEW para robóticos, mecatrónicos e ingenieros. Temario: Capítulo 1 Introducción Sistemas empotrados (embebidos) Arquitectura abierta del sistema arduino Capítulo 2 Instalación de Arduino Instalación Ambiente de programación Puesta a punto Ejemplo blink Ejemplo DigitalReadSerial Más ejemplos Capítulo 3 Plataforma Electrónica Arquitectura AVR Modelos de tarjetas arduino Capítulo 4 Lenguaje C Para empezar que es lenguaje C Empezando a programar en C Variables Operadores Arreglos Funciones Instrucciones de programación If If-else If anidada Switch Operador “?” For While Do-while Break Continue

description

Temario Curso Arduino con Matlab y Labview

Transcript of Curso Arduino Con Matlab y LabVIEW

Page 1: Curso Arduino Con Matlab y LabVIEW

INCULCAMOS RAZONAMIENTO

Arduino + MATLAB + LabVIEW

Nivel Básico - Avanzado

Curso Arduino con Matlab y LabVIEW para

robóticos, mecatrónicos e ingenieros.

Temario: Capítulo 1 Introducción

Sistemas empotrados (embebidos)

Arquitectura abierta del sistema arduino

Capítulo 2 Instalación de Arduino Instalación

Ambiente de programación

Puesta a punto

Ejemplo blink

Ejemplo DigitalReadSerial

Más ejemplos

Capítulo 3 Plataforma Electrónica Arquitectura AVR

Modelos de tarjetas arduino

Capítulo 4 Lenguaje C Para empezar que es lenguaje C

Empezando a programar en C

Variables

Operadores

Arreglos

Funciones

Instrucciones de programación

If

If-else

If anidada

Switch

Operador “?”

For

While

Do-while

Break

Continue

Page 2: Curso Arduino Con Matlab y LabVIEW

INCULCAMOS RAZONAMIENTO

Arduino + MATLAB + LabVIEW

Nivel Básico - Avanzado

Capítulo 5 Apuntadores, Estructuras y uniones Apuntadores

Estructuras

Uniones

Capítulo 6 Librerías y funciones de Arduino Stdio.h

Stdlib.h

Funciones mateméticas

Funciones arduino

Funciones fundamentales

Tipos de conversión

Funciones para puertos digitales entrada/salida

Manipulación de bits

Funciones para entradas analógicas

Adquisición de señales analógicas

Termómetro

Funciones time

Funciones matemáticas

Función map(…)

Funciones para generar y detener tonos

Funciones para procesar bits y bytes

Serial

Librerias estándar C

Librerias Arduino

Funciones Arduino

Interrupciones y aplicaciones

Capítulo 7 Servos Introducción

Motores de corriente directa

Motor Shield

Librería Servo.h

Motores a pasos

Parámetros importantes

Motores a pasos con magneto permanente

Motores a pasos unipolares

Motores a pasos bipolares

Librería Stepper.h

EJEMPLOS

Page 3: Curso Arduino Con Matlab y LabVIEW

INCULCAMOS RAZONAMIENTO

Arduino + MATLAB + LabVIEW

Nivel Básico - Avanzado

Capítulo 8 Arduino con MATLAB Introducción

Información Arduino con MATLAB (IMPORTANTE)

Integración Numérica

Diferenciación Numérica

Registro de resultados de trabajo

Protocolo de comunicación

Adquisición de datos MATLAB

Arduino desde MATLAB

Capítulo 9 Control Introducción

Sistemas de segundo orden

Ejemplos de sistemas discretos

Simulación de sistemas dinámicos

Aspectos a considerar en las tarjetas Arduino

Algoritmos de control

Control de un péndulo

Control de temperatura

Control de temperatura PID

Regla de sincronía del control de temperatura PID

Implementación práctica del control PID

Ejemplos con la Arduino Intel Galileo

Capítulo 10 Bluetooth Introducción

Bluetooth

Arquitectura de los dispositivos Bluetooth

Especificaciones técnicas

Aplicaciones Bluetooth

Librerías para comunicación serial

Librería SoftwareSerial del Sistema Arduino

Módulo de Bluetooth

Funciones de puerto serial Bluetooth de MATLAB

Bluetooth Arduino + MATLAB

Comunicación inalámbrica

Ejemplos y aplicaciones de control

Page 4: Curso Arduino Con Matlab y LabVIEW

INCULCAMOS RAZONAMIENTO

Arduino + MATLAB + LabVIEW

Nivel Básico - Avanzado

Capítulo 11 Ethernet Teoría de Ethernet

Tecnología de Ethernet

Trama de Ethernet

Arduino Ethernet Shield

Librería Ethernet

EthernetServer

Client class

Configuración cliente/servidor

Ejemplos

Capítulo 12 Manejo de interrupciones Introducción

Tipos de interrupciones

Rutinas de servicio de interrupciones

Aplicaciones de control en tiempo real

Capítulo 13 WiFi Introducción

WiFi

Puntos de Acceso

Wifi Shield

Capítulo 14 Arduino + LabVIEW Introducción

Ambiente de programación LabVIEW

Programación con LabVIEW

Adquisición y desplegado de datos